over 4 years agoThe walking trail is the highlight of this beautiful place. Everyday my sister and I walk it twice, about 5 miles altogether. Some is gravel, some sidewalk; the entire trail around the lake is amazing. There are ducks everywhere that the whole county comes to feed (even in the winter they are here), there are paddleboats, shuffleboard, a playground, a seasonal pool, tennis, two bridges…it’s a great place to spend some time. But…be aware this is a Methodist Retreat and the people can get snippy at any given time. I have been stopped and told me pants were too short and that it was an abomination. Trust me, they weren’t. Also be sure not to swear, as this can get you kicked off the lake grounds, and fishing is all but forbidden except for two small spots. Also there is NO SWIMMING allowed ever. Bummer but from the looks of the water…may be a good idea. Expect big crowds in the summer espeacially JUNE. Just stay away from the place the first 2 weeks of June, it’s a nightmare when all the delegates come to elect new members.
